What will the apprentice be doing?

At Change Grow Live, you will be working towards a Business Admin Level 3 apprenticeship over the course of 15 months, alongside your daily roles and responsibilities as a Clinical Admin Apprentice.

Your roles and responsibilities include;

- Develop and nurture sound relationships with both CGL Business Support and external office and equipment suppliers.

- To provide advice, information and reports clearly and concisely via the most appropriate channel, whilst being sensitive to the needs of the audience.

- Maintain accurate and comprehensive records/data collection on clients as required by the relevant policies and procedures.

- Be the main port of call for all data relating matters as well as undertake regular and ad-hoc requests from the Service Manager/Data Analyst, Regional Data Manager, and other CRI Senior Management.

- Support to collection of data to enable production or Prescriptions and recording.

- Attend relevant meetings and forums as requested.

About the employer

CGL is a health and social care charity working with individuals, families and communities across England and Wales that are affected by drugs, alcohol, crime, homelessness, domestic abuse, and antisocial behaviour. Their projects, delivered in communities and prisons, encourage and empower people to regain control of their lives and motivate them to tackle their problems.
